WebIn ammonia: Physical properties of ammonia. …The ammonia molecule has a trigonal pyramidal shape with the three hydrogen atoms and an unshared pair of electrons attached to the nitrogen atom. It is a polar molecule and is highly associated because of strong intermolecular hydrogen bonding. The dielectric constant of ammonia (22 at −34 °C ... WebNov 17, 2016 · You can see the lone pair (nonbonding) of electrons directly above the nitrogen. The nonbonding pair of electrons pushes away from the bonding pairs producing a trigonal pyramidal shape.
